Massimo Castronuovo

Massimo Castronuovo

Joined Artfinder: November 2022

Artworks for sale: 31

Location Italy

Artworks by Massimo Castronuovo

25 - 31 of 31 artworks
Shop section
Minus
Options
Minus
Reset all filters